Completor freezes on python autocomplete, certain modules

Opened this issue · 3 comments

Hi,

first of all, completor is amazing. I've been using it for > 1 year, and it does a very good job. Light, simple, nothing to complain about. I use it at home on my linux machine and at work on my mac machine.

Sometimes, completor freezes vim completely. The issue seems hard to reproduce, but on my mac machine at work, it regularly (but not always) freezes on:

  • pandas.Dat... (it freezes while I type, when I'm around the t...)
  • import ipdb; ipdb.s... (it freezes on the s)

I work with iterm2 and inside a virtualven. Jedi is installed the virtualenv.

At home on my linux machine, I observe more or less the same behaviour, but it's less frequent.
When the freeze happens, I need to completely close the tab of my terminal, keyboard has no effect.

Any idea what might cause that, or how I could start debuging the issue?

I've also been experiencing this and just checked to see if I should open an issue.

I have a very similar setup -- macOS, iTerm2, virtualenv. I've been noticing this happening for the last few weeks, but haven't noticed any patterns about when it freezes or which libraries it freezes on. It does seem to freeze when the autocomplete kicks in and I've verified that disabling completor stops vim from freezing.

I've found that resizing the terminal window unfreezes vim, so it might be a weird interaction between how iTerm2 renders text and something inside vim. If I type while vim is frozen some characters do seem to get written to the buffer.
